
Wprowadzenie do kodów QR
Kody QR stały się niezbędnym narzędziem do współczesnego dzielenia się danymi i marketingu. dostarczają one kompaktowy, skanowany format, który może kodować szeroką gamę informacji. w tym tutorialze .NET pokażemy Ci, jak programowo Stworzyć kod QR w C# za pomocą wtyczki Aspose.BarCode 2D Barcode Writer. Ten przewodnik jest idealny dla deweloperów, którzy chcą zintegrować dynamiczną generację kodów QR do aplikacji desktopowych lub ASP.NET.
Krok 1: Zainstaluj Aspose.BarCode dla generacji kodów QR
Aby rozpocząć generowanie kodów QR, zainstaluj Aspose.BarCode dla biblioteki .NET. Ta solidna biblioteka ułatwia tworzenie i rozpoznawanie różnych typów kodów pasków, w tym kodów QR.
Pobierz Aspose.BarCode DLL z oficjalnej strony pobierania.
Użyj programu NuGet Package Manager, wykonując następujące polecenie w konsoli Package Manager:
PM> Install-Package Aspose.BarCode
Aby uzyskać kompletne rozwiązanie, zwróć uwagę na nasz $99 Aspose Plugin, który oferuje szerokie funkcje generowania wysokiej jakości kodów rzęs, w tym generator kodu QR .
Krok 2: Generuj podstawowy kod QR w C#
Tworzenie podstawowego kodu QR jest proste. postępuj zgodnie z następującymi krokami:
- Natychmiast A
BarcodeGenerator
Obiekt, określając typ kodu QR wraz z pożądanymi tekstami. - Opcjonalnie skonfiguruj opcje dostosowania, takie jak poziom korekty błędu.
- Generuj kod QR i przechowuj go jako plik obrazu.
Poniżej znajduje się przykład C#, który pokazuje podstawowe ** generowanie kodów QR**:
using Aspose.BarCode;
using Aspose.BarCode.Generation;
// Create a new BarcodeGenerator instance for QR Code
BarcodeGenerator generator = new BarcodeGenerator(EncodeTypes.QR, "Sample QR Code Content");
// Save the generated QR Code image
generator.Save("QRCode.png", BarCodeImageFormat.Png);
Krok 3: Generuj kod QR za pomocą ustawień dostosowanych
Aby jeszcze bardziej dostosować swój kod QR, możesz dostosować ustawienia, takie jak poziomy korekcji błędów i wymiary.
- Zacznij od
BarcodeGenerator
z pożądanymi kodami QR. - Ustaw właściwości, takie jak poziom korekty błędu, rozmiar modułu i marginy, aby odpowiadać wymaganiom aplikacji.
- Generuj kod QR i przechowuj go w pożądanej formie.
Poniżej znajduje się odcinek przedstawiający Kod QR dostosowany w C#:
using Aspose.BarCode;
using Aspose.BarCode.Generation;
// Create a BarcodeGenerator instance for QR Code
BarcodeGenerator generator = new BarcodeGenerator(EncodeTypes.QR, "Customized QR Code Content");
// Customize error correction level (e.g., High, Medium, Low)
generator.Parameters.Barcode.QR.QRCodeErrorLevel = QRCodeErrorLevel.H;
// Set additional customization options if needed
generator.Parameters.Barcode.XDimension.Pixels = 2;
// Save the customized QR Code image
generator.Save("CustomizedQRCode.png", BarCodeImageFormat.Png);
Krok 4: Odkryj więcej z darmową licencją
Aby w pełni wykorzystać zdolności Aspose.BarCode, rozważ żądanie Darmowe licencje tymczasowe. Dzięki temu możesz odkryć .NET QR Code Generation za pomocą Aspose i uzyskać dostęp do dodatkowych zaawansowanych funkcji dostępnych w naszym pliku .NET Plugin.
Aby uzyskać więcej szczegółów, proszę skontaktować się z oficjalnymi forumami dokumentacji i wsparcia Aspose.BarCode.
konkluzja
Ten przewodnik dostarczył istotnych informacji na temat generowania kodów QR z opcjami dostosowywanymi w C#. Poprzez te kroki można bezproblemowo zintegrować generację kodu QR do swojego pulpitu lub aplikacji ASP.NET.
Dodatkowo, jeśli jesteś zainteresowany bardziej szczegółowymi wdrażaniami, możesz chcieć spojrzeć na jak generować kod QR w ASP.NET za pomocą C# lub jak utworzyć kod QR w C # za pośrednictwem innych bibliotek. Istnieją również opcje, aby użyć generatora kodów rzęs 2D dla różnych typów danych, zapewniając, że Twoje aplikacje mogą spełniać różne potrzeby. Niezależnie od tego, czy szukasz C# Generator Kodów QR lub prostego QR kody .NET Core rozwiązania, możliwości są szerokie.
More in this category
- Co to jest GS1 DataBar (RSS-14)? Przewodnik po zastosowaniach, typach i generacjach
- Generuj ITF-14 i Interleaved 2 z 5 kodów barowych dla etykiet kartonowych i logistycznych
- Generuj kod 39 i kod 39, pełny kod barowy ASCII z przystosowanym tekstem w .NET
- Generuj kody rzędu GS1 Data Matrix za pomocą Aspose.BarCode dla .NET
- Generuj MSI, Plessey i Standard 2 z 5 kodów barowych dla etykiet magazynowych w .NET